Output 21b68ae3e66acdfec410d2db5118874512f5d0bf3d27ff03366b191adc943adf:2

value
107882266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3727839900e0496fdaef006ba6de50a40b9a1529 OP_EQUAL
address
MCvnjTwwD7AN7gJidoEBrXsV8MKcSHBWeP
transaction
21b68ae3e66acdfec410d2db5118874512f5d0bf3d27ff03366b191adc943adf
spent
true